Energy Savings of Warehouse Lighting in LED
Switching to LED lighting in warehouses can lead to impressive energy savings. Below is a table that outlines different types of warehouse lighting fixtures, their applications, typical mounting heights, and the energy savings percentage achieved by upgrading to LED.
Lighting Fixture Type | Application | Typical Mounting Height | Energy Savings (%) |
---|---|---|---|
High Bay Lights | Large open areas | 20-40 feet | 60% |
Low Bay Lights | Smaller spaces | 12-20 feet | 50% |
Linear Strip Lights | Aisles and shelving | 8-15 feet | 55% |
Flood Lights | Outdoor areas | Variable | 65% |
These figures highlight the potential for significant reductions in energy usage, which can translate into lower utility bills and a reduced carbon footprint for businesses in Orinda.
Every Warehouse in Orinda city, California is Different
Understanding the unique characteristics of each warehouse in Orinda is crucial when planning an upgrade to LED lighting. The first step is to assess the existing lighting setup. This involves identifying the types and models of current fixtures, their wattage, and input voltage. Additionally, measuring the dimensions of the warehouse facility is essential to determine the appropriate lighting layout and fixture placement.
Knowing the major operations conducted within the warehouse is also vital. For instance, a facility primarily used for storage may have different lighting needs compared to one that handles manufacturing or assembly. The type of work being done can influence the brightness and distribution of light required, ensuring that all areas are adequately illuminated for safety and productivity.
These factors are integral to selecting the right LED lighting solutions that not only meet the operational demands but also enhance the overall efficiency of the warehouse.
Other Considerations for Orinda city, California
When selecting lighting fixtures for warehouses in Orinda, it’s important to consider local climate-specific conditions. Orinda’s climate can affect the performance and longevity of lighting fixtures, making it essential to choose products that can withstand local environmental factors.
Moreover, local codes or utility rebates may necessitate the inclusion of lighting controls such as daylight sensors and motion sensor controls. These controls can further enhance energy efficiency by ensuring that lights are only used when necessary, thus reducing unnecessary energy consumption.
The benefits of incorporating these lighting controls extend beyond energy savings. They can also improve the overall lighting quality and contribute to a more sustainable operation, aligning with Orinda’s commitment to environmental responsibility.
